Output 954366a015ee6955e2d23f4fa8519d0d15e5acae51f81d425a7179389f363234:3

value
9221259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a327f5e3e3e97031ce034ec7b8f9e57d7c76ca5 OP_EQUAL
address
3EHjfeSeKtN7rtSo1nfQ5Qkvbx5nkwsjwr
transaction
954366a015ee6955e2d23f4fa8519d0d15e5acae51f81d425a7179389f363234
confirmations
454446
spent
true